HOUSE OF DELEGATES


BILLS INTRODUCED


Tuesday, February 20, 2007


3135.By Mr. Speaker (Mr. Thompson) and Del. Armstead [By Request of the Executive] - Relating to the soft drinks tax - To Finance


3136.By Mr. Speaker (Mr. Thompson) [By Request of the Executive] - Relating to the Severance and Business Privilege Tax Act and the Workers' Compensation Debt Reduction Act - To Finance


3137.By Del. Moye, Kessler, Stephens, Rodighiero, Eldridge, Ellis, Pino, Sobonya and Sumner - Prohibiting school employees from transporting any student to obtain an abortion without parental consent - To Education then Judiciary


3138.By Del. Webster, Moore, Proudfoot, Pino, Shook, Fleischauer, Stemple, Mahan, Brown, Tabb and Guthrie - Requiring that private club and tavern licensees carry a minimum amount of general liability and liquor liability insurance to protect patrons - To Judiciary


3139.By Del. Ellem - Providing all persons convicted of a felony are subject to DNA testing - To Judiciary


3140.By Del. Canterbury, Evans, Anderson and Lane - Allowing property owners and lessees to kill a bear discovered damaging real and personal property - To Agriculture and Natural Resources then Judiciary


3141.By Del. Amores, Varner and Stemple - Relating to whom assessors may issue proof of payment of personal property taxes - To Finance


3142.By Del. Iaquinta, Hartman, Williams, Martin, Miley, Talbott, Barker and Wells - Prohibiting fractional pricing in the retail sale of gasoline - To Judiciary


3143.By Del. Fleischauer, Brown, Lane, Hrutkay, Schadler, Pino, Guthrie, Webster, Burdiss, Longstreth and Moore - Creating the West Virginia Correctional Center Nursery Act - To Judiciary


3144.By Del. Fleischauer, Shook, Longstreth, Brown, Wells, Hatfield, Hamilton and Doyle - Relating to primary elections and nominating procedures of third-party candidates - To Judiciary
